Church members in the Ecclesiastical District of Oregon warmly welcomed their guests, along with the doctrinal instructees and prospective members, during the musical evangelical mission on July 30, 2023. This propagational event was held in the Mt. Hood Community College Theater in Gresham, Oregon.

Officially opening the event, Brother Rod Reyes, district Christian Family Organizations (CFO) overseer, gave the welcome remarks to all attendees. This was followed by musical performances from selected brethren in the district.

“It’s inspiring for me to see everybody smiling, not only my fellow performers, but also our audience,” said Kyle Cabalitasan, one of the performers.

Halfway through the musical portion of the activity, Brother Armando Caguinguin, district Light Of Salvation overseer, delivered a short message, welcoming and recognizing the guests, doctrinal instructees, and prospective members. Afterwards, the musical performances resumed.

Then came the highlight of this propagational activity—the study of the words of God led by district supervising minister Brother Dernilo Pascua. In his homily, he pointed out from the Holy Scriptures the process by which man can attain salvation. Citing Mark 16:15–16, Brother Pascua taught that one must first be preached the gospel to, believe in it, and receive the true baptism in order to be saved.

“We show our love for our fellowmen, which is why we do our best to invite them to activities such as this. It is our desire that they, too, receive the blessings we enjoy as Church Of Christ members, especially the hope for salvation,” conveyed Brother Pascua. — With reports from Jillian Pimentel of INC News Section
